   <description><![CDATA[<p><strong>iPhoto</strong> is Apple's flagship application for managing and viewing photos on your Mac.</p><p>The interface is very slick and iPhoto features tons of tools to help you manage your library. In fact, the real strength of the program resides in the organizing options such as organizing by events, create a gallery, print out calendars and books etc. In particular, the unified search function allows you to quickly find any photo based on all sorts of criteria like date, name or keywords and now, even faces.</p><p>One of my favorite features of iPhoto are the photo montages which allow you to select a style of presentation with accompanying music. These look great and are a nice way to view your photos and reminisce on the past. However, I dislike the way iPhoto has to build a library file of your photos. If you've already got several GB of photos on your system, you don't want another huge iPhoto file taking up space on your hard drive.</p><p>Of course, iPhoto is also very well integrated into other Apple apps such as iDVD so your iPhoto images can easily be used in videos that you're editing.    <description><![CDATA[<img src="http://screenshots.en.sftcdn.net/en/scrn/42000/42176/moviemontage001.jpg" border="0" align="right" style="margin:0px 5px 5px;" /> <p>Movie Montage does for movies what iPhoto does for photos. With many digital cameras shooting small movie files and the proliferation of consumer DV cameras there is no easy way on your Mac to look at folders of movies all at once.</p><p>Movie Montage solves this problem by allowing you quick access to movies all in one window, automatic full screen slideshows, easy file renaming, batch exporting using any codec Quicktime supports and the ability to save your favorite folders right in the application.</p><p>Download <a title="Movie Montage 3.3.1" href="http://movie-montage.en.softonic.com/mac"><strong>Movie Montage 3.3.1</strong></a> in <a title="Free software downloads and reviews - Softonic" href="http://en.softonic.com/">Softonic</a></p>]]></description>

   <description><![CDATA[<img src="http://screenshots.en.sftcdn.net/en/scrn/69000/69848/1.jpg" border="0" align="right" style="margin:0px 5px 5px;" /> <p>ImageFlow Fx is a complementary addition to Final Cut Studio and Motion to allow you to add stunning animations to your movie edits.</p>
<p>ImageFlow Fx basically consists of a pack of animations designed to speed up the process of adding animations to video editing in Final Cut Studio and Motion. If you want to create animated photo-montages, then ImageFlow Fx can create complex animations from a folder of images allowing you to select the pace and effect and then instantly preview the result.</p>
<p>In total, you have access to about 14 animation effects from simple zoom effects to sophisticated melt and Polaroid effects. ImageFlow is also perfect for DVD menu backgrounds, motion graphics promos, documentary photo montage, real estate sales videos, digital signage, titles sequences among other uses.</p>
